Output 33f70602f429348b7d29cd7c811eb0323d0da94793592b8ac14140cca9af2956:0

value
673651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13ab709fb3f898b9a3db56fec6d189cccfdf33e5 OP_EQUAL
address
33V293WrfjvU6ivT7aoy22m7ATev58Xde2
transaction
33f70602f429348b7d29cd7c811eb0323d0da94793592b8ac14140cca9af2956